Air defense systems protect nations from airborne threats. These systems have evolved over the years to become more sophisticated and effective. The most advanced air defense systems today use a mix of radar, missiles, and other technology to detect and neutralize threats.
Radar is a key part of air defense. It helps detect incoming aircraft, missiles, and drones. Modern radars can track multiple targets at once. They can also distinguish between different types of threats. This allows for quick and accurate responses.
Missiles are the main tool used to intercept and destroy threats. They come in various types, each designed for specific tasks. Some are short-range, meant for close threats. Others are long-range, capable of hitting targets far away. These missiles are often guided by radar or other sensors. This ensures they hit their targets with high precision.
Advanced air defense systems also use other technologies. Some use lasers to disable or destroy threats. Others use electronic warfare to jam or confuse enemy radar and communications. These technologies add extra layers of defense.
Integration is a key feature of advanced air defense systems. They link various components into a single, cohesive unit. This allows for better coordination and faster responses. For example, radar can detect a threat and send data to a command center. The command center can then launch the appropriate missile to intercept the threat. This all happens in seconds.
Training and maintenance are crucial for these systems. Operators need to know how to use the technology effectively. Regular maintenance ensures the system remains operational. This involves checking and servicing all components, from radar to missiles.
The development of air defense systems is ongoing. Engineers and scientists work to improve existing technology and create new solutions. This includes making radar more sensitive and increasing missile range and accuracy. It also involves developing new technologies, such as hypersonic missiles.
Air defense systems are vital for national security. They protect against a range of threats, from enemy aircraft to ballistic missiles. As technology advances, these systems become more effective and reliable. This ensures nations can defend themselves against ever-evolving threats.
